Tubbercurry, Co. Sligo
Mountain Road
18 sales have been filed on the Property Price Register for Mountain Road since 2012, at a median of €78,750.
They ran from €26,000 to €215,000. None of them was a new build.

Why this street and not others
A street gets a page once at least 5 sales have been recorded on it. Below that a median is a handful of anecdotes rather than a figure, and a page saying so would be worse than no page.
Source: Property Services Regulatory Authority, used under the Creative Commons Attribution 4.0 licence. Sales that were not at arm’s length are excluded throughout.
